The Principal District and Sessions Judge, P. Velmurugan, on Tuesday convicted and sentenced an auto driver to undergo life imprisonment for murdering a retired sub inspector in K.K. Nagar area here in March 2010.
Delivering the verdict, the Judge imposed a fine of Rs. 2,000 on the auto driver S. Sivakumar of Khajamalai.
The retired Sub Inspector Joseph Jayaraj (75) was found dead in an open place near LIC colony in K.K. Nagar area. The K.K. Nagar police which initially registered a case under suspicious death subsequently altered it as a case of murder for gain and arrested Sivakumar a few days after the murder took place.
During investigation, it came to light that the auto driver had strangulated the retired Sub Inspector to death in an inebriated condition after the latter refused to lend him money to clear the dues for the auto-rickshaw.
The auto driver took away gold chain weighing five sovereigns from the retired police officer after murdering him.
